System and method for adjusting automatic sensitivity control parameters based on intracardiac electrogram signals

摘要

Systems and methods are provided for use by an implantable medical device capable of automatically adjusting the sensitivity with which electrical cardiac signals are sensed within a patient, i.e. a device equipped with Automatic Sensitivity Control (ASC.) In a first example, ASC parameters are automatically adjusted by the device itself based on parameters derived from both R-waves and T-waves and further based on a detected noise floor. In a second example, a profile representative of the shape of cardiac signals is generated by the device. ASC parameters are then adjusted based on the profile. In various embodiments, histograms are used to determine sizes and shapes of the R-waves and T-waves via statistical prevalence techniques. The histograms are also employed to derive the aforementioned profile.
